The Weights and Measures Agency (WMA) in Tanzania is a semi-autonomous government body operating under the Ministry of Industry and Trade. Established in 2002 under the Executive Agencies Act (Cap 245), it replaced the old Weights and Measures Bureau. The agency operates to improve public service delivery and enforce strict legal metrological control across the nation. Its primary mandate is to protect consumers and ensure fair trade transactions by controlling all measuring systems. The WMA enforces compliance with the Weights and Measures Act (Cap 340). To do this, officers regularly conduct the calibration, verification, and re-verification of all commercial measuring instruments. Their oversight spans diverse economic sectors, including verify petrol pumps at fuel stations, testing counter scales in retail markets, and certifying large vehicle tank scales at major transport hubs like the Mwanza Calibration Bay. By standardizing measurement metrics, the WMA aligns Tanzania with national and international metrology standards. It collaborates with higher learning institutions like the College of Business Education (CBE) to train professionals in metrology and standardization. Ultimately, the agency protects citizens from short-measurement fraud, builds regional business confidence, and secures the country’s economic integrity.
